The Province of Ontario confirmed another 477 cases of COVID-19 this morning and 63 more deaths. Meanwhile another 421 people have fully recovered from the virus.
ONTARIO - The Province of Ontario has confirmed 477 new cases of COVID-19 this morning, bringing the total number of cases in the Province to 19,598.
The Province also confirmed another 63 deaths bringing the total to 1,540. Meanwhile another 421 have fully recovered from COVID-19, bringing the total of resolved cases to 13,990.
We currently have 1,028 COVID-19 patients in the hospital, 213 are in the ICU and 166 are in the ICU on a ventilator. The Province completed 16,295 tests yesterday.
